I found that the balancing moisurizer did not replenish enough moisturize to my 4b hair and I use nexxus humectress or any brand cholesteral mixed with couple of teaspoon castor oil (or some other natural oils) after each hard core protein treament. I rate aphogee okay and highly recommend nexxus emergencee as excellent compared to aphogee. Emergencee IS more expensive but well worth the extra dollars. I use aphogee only when I'm flat broke -- otherwise I do emergencee or wait until I have the cash.

To address your current problem of dryness, I recommend a thick creamy leave in mixed with a 2 teaspoons of a natural oil (nexxus headdress is my favorite mixed with castor oil) this combination always provide enough moisture to my 4b hair. I also suggest washing and doing a deep moisturizing conditioner in 2-3 days or as soon as you can manage. If it were me I'd wash again next day and deep moisturize.

I hope you don't mean you're using the 2 step protein treatment every week, that's really hard core and should be used every 6-8 weeks only.

If you're using the 2 minute eery week but your hair is dry stop using it so often and use a moisturizing deep conditioner every week.

I was recently watching a YouTube video where a girl was using the Aphogee protein treatment every week and she was complaining about the state of her hair. I cringed inwardly while watching, the setback could have easily have been avoided if she had just read the instructions. :nono:

As for Aphogee itself, yes I find it to be incredibly effective. I've not used it for a while now because my hair feels strong enough with the regular, milder treatments that I'm using.
